About Hollowforth House
Hollowforth House is a detached house in Woodplumpton, Preston, Preston (PR4 0BD). It has a recorded floor area of 392 m² (around 4219 sq ft), construction records dating it to before 1900 and council tax band C. The latest certificate (March 2015) shows a G (score 18), near the bottom of the EPC scale. The recommended improvements would lift it to D (score 60), a 3-band jump. Main heating runs on oil. The latest certificate is from March 2015, so improvements made since then won't be reflected.
Held since May 2009 — that's 17 years off the open market, well above the local norm. That sale fell during the post-crash dip, which often skews comparisons against later neighbouring sales. At 392 m² the property is well over the postcode median (160 m² across 7 EPCs), placing it in the larger end of the local stock. On energy efficiency it sits in the bottom 10% of properties in this postcode — significant headroom for improvement. Today's modelled estimate of £527,000 sits 151% above the 2009 sale of £210,000.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£50/sq ft) was about 70% below the postcode norm. One historical planning record sits against the property in 2006.

Planning history
1 application on record at Hollowforth House, Hollowforth Lane, Woodplumpton, Preston, PR4 0BD
- Oct 2006Change Of UseFullOutcome in report
Change of use of land from agricultural use to domestic use for the formation of a private tennis court involving engineering operations to reduce site levels and the erection of a 2.75 metre high perimeter fence
